Famous golfers


 Tiger Woods is currently number 1 golfer in the world. His real name is Eldrick Tont Woods and he is the best paid athlete in the world (about $100 millions only in 2010). He has all the tiles that he could get, winning : four times the Masters Tournament, three times the U.S. Open, three times the Open Championship and four times the PGA Championship. And these are only the major tournaments. He turned professional in 1996 and he is well-known for his long drives. He was coached by Butch Harmon and Hank Haney.


 Jack (William) Nicklaus or the “Golden Bear” has 18 titles in major tournaments, with four more than Tiger Woods: six times the Masters Tournament, four times the U.S. Open, three times the Open Championship and five times the PGA Championship. He also haves his own tournament, called “The Memorial Tournament”. Jack Nicklaus wrote his autobiography, called “My story”. He is also the author of some golf books where he give instructions : “Play Better Golf: The Short Game and Scoring”, “My Most Memorable Shots in the Majors” etc. Jack Nicklaus began his career in 1961 and now he has his own museum located in his hometown.


 Arnold Palmer is now 80 years old but he is still in the heart of golf lovers, who gave him the nickname “the king”. Arnold’s father workes as a greenskeeper at a local golf club so Arnold had the chance to play and learn golf. He turned professional in 1954 and he won several major events, including the Masters Tournament,U.S. Open, The Open Championship and PGA Championship. He also worked very hard to popularize the sport in the world. He was awarded by President Bush with the “Presidential medal of freedom”.


 Gary Player is also considered one of the greatest players of golf. His nickname is “the Black Knight”. Borned at Johannesburg, he turned professional at the age of 18. We won 9 major events: three times The Masters Tournament, just one time the U.S. Open (in 1965), three times the Open Championship and two times the PGA Championship. He has his own company, called Gary Player Design and he designs golf courses all over the world (in 35 countries).


 Bobby Jones was a golfer that never had the chance to turn professional. He was born in 1902 and he won 13 major championships, including the masters Tournament and The Open Championship.
